that's a good question actually

I answered this in the ask Alicia a

while ago the difference between

persuade and convince to persuade

someone is used when we want someone to

take action so like persuade someone to

do something convince is used when we

want to change someone's idea about

something like convince someone of

something convince someone that

smartphones are harmful to our health

for example it's a persuade action

convinced idea that's the difference

phones emit radiation here another point

that lots of you have asked questions

about before this said I have it here in

past tense my friend said you may hear

this used in present tense for example

my friend says so what's the difference

here when you use said when you use a

simple past tense here when you use said

it's like that thing happened once in

the past so my friend said this thing

one time and it's done if however you

use the present tense it's referring to

something they often say my friend says

so it's like a topic they talk about a

lot you'll see this sort of thing in the

news a lot so politicians when we talk

about politicians in the news we see

this used a lot like Trump says blah

blah blah it's because it's something he

regularly says so when you see this

present tense used it's referring to a

regularly stated thing when you see past

tense used it's like maybe once just

once so this is the difference someone

third in publication in publication

this word publication publication so in

this newspaper in this magazine on this

blog probably not a blog in this journal

author author means the person who wrote

something this is a really good

pronunciation point to that th sound

author author th author in publication

author there are three words here wrote

suggested and stated so you'll notice

all of these are past tense because

we're talking about something this

author previously like wrote previously

said in their paper or in in this

publication so for example in Time

magazine Beyonce suggested that

smartphones are harmful to your health I

don't know why Beyonce's talking about

that but for example so if Beyonce read

an article in Time magazine this is how

I would describe the article if in Time

magazine Beyonce suggested smartphones

are harmful to your health so what's the

difference between wrote suggested and

stated wrote is just very clearly words

on a screen like words on in text

suggested means they didn't explicitly

say something explicitly means clearly

directly they didn't directly say

something stated is more used in speech

but you can use it for like more formal

writing so if you're reading like a PhD

thesis for example you might use stated

in in this paper Professor X stated that

Wolverine is a good mutant okay I have
